Well, becoming popular is PERCEIVED as a NECESSITY by most students and honestly, I do agree that it’s an important thing. But it’s not the only thing. The reason I begin by emphasising this important point is because of the numerous college-going adolescents who have either developed low confidence and/or low self-esteem issues, some form of identity crisis or slipped into a depression due to it.
Hence, here are my two simple MANTRAS that shall make you popular with the RIGHT PEOPLE and become a STRONG VOICE!
1. Just be human
The one thing that had made me hugely successful in getting things done or enjoy SPECIAL ATTENTION from staff and lecturers was that I’d treat everyone with utmost GENUINE RESPECT and REMEMBER THEIR NAMES, especially the ones who were considered insignificant. I’m referring to the security guard, the cleaning staff, gardeners and bus drivers.
The bonus outcome: The popularity with the staff automatically made me quite popular with the lecturers which in turn made me appear very influential to my classmates, which automatically made me popular but also the go-to guy in case anyone needed help or any kind of assistance. It really didn’t matter whether I could actually help out or not, but I was in the loop with almost everyone.  
How does this help in making yourself heard? Well, you’re in the right spot. To act as an intermediary between the students and the management and also to be able to INITIATE the process of CHANGE with the students using your popularity.
2. Initiate, initiate and initiate!
We all adore, adorn and love leaders. The main ingredient to becoming one is to be a person who takes initiative. It might be a small activity to full-fledged planning of an event. Volunteer and take initiative. It has a lot of advantages. It not only teaches you practical skills but will also give the REAL WORLD EXPERIENCE of understanding and handling the different DYNAMICS that MATTER. Once you take initiative, you’ll also be the person who will be noticed and that in turn will enable you to organise events and bring together people for a cause.
